The Wright Institute is a graduate school located in Berkeley, California, founded in 1968. It focuses on clinical psychology and counseling, offering a Doctor of Psychology (PsyD) and a Master of Arts (MA) in Counseling Psychology, with an emphasis on understanding social issues and lifelong learning.

Student loan default rate
The share of student borrowers who default on federal loans within three years, against the national benchmark.
Of 106 borrowers who entered repayment, 0 (0.0%) defaulted within three years — below the 2.3% national rate.
Default rate vs national, by cohort
* Cohorts 2020 and later read near 0% because the federal COVID-19 payment pause (CARES Act) suspended defaults nationwide. These years reflect a national policy, not institutional performance; the 2019 cohort is the last measured under normal repayment.
